The description sounds very ambiguous to me, could some please help me understand?
Here is the original description of this menu:
Note: with this option enabled, the router's clients must access the Internet through VPN. If the router is not configured with VPN, the router's clients will not be able to access the network.
What does it mean saying that if the router is not configured with VPN? I am using the router as a VPN client, will that work?
Or does this mean I need to access the router via a VPN client, meaning the router must be the VPN server?
The text was updated successfully, but these errors were encountered:
Note: with this option enabled, the router must set up and run the client VPN before the router's clients can access the Internet.
Some our customers very care about the privacy, so they want the router to run the vpn client all the time, if the vpn client is not running, the clients are not allow to access the Internet.
